Most blades for cutting green concrete are designed for use with special early-entry saws that minimize joint raveling and spalling. Wet-cutting blades are typically used with walk-behind saws for cutting joints in cured concrete flatwork because water cooling permits deeper cuts. Although it’s possible to use most dry-cutting blades with water, never use a wet-cutting blade dry. Always continuously cool the blade with water to avoid segment loss and blade warpage. Dry-cutting blades have segment welds that resist heat and don’t require water for cooling. They are usually intended for intermittent cutting and for use on handheld, low-horsepower saws.

The soft bonds are mostly made up of soft metals for example Bronze and are common when cutting very hard less abrasive material like marble. The hard bonds are mostly made up of hard metals for example Tungsten Carbide and are common when used for cutting very soft abrasive materials like asphalt or freshly poured concrete. One additional consideration is when using diamond blades on concrete with steel in it. Rebar is the backbone of concrete construction and the bane of bits and blades alike. If cutting rebar when exposed, a diamond blade will make quick work of the cut, but it greatly reduces the life of the blade. This is because diamond blades “cut” by grinding the material as opposed to other blades that rip and tear. When cutting concrete where rebar is sure to be found, it is often best to use a continuous rim blade with a supply of water. Conceptually, turbo rim blades are very similar in appearance to continuous rim blades in that both have no teeth. However, turbo rim blades are serrated, which gives them a lot more raw cutting power. Because of this, turbo rim blades are the kind of saw blades that you want to use when you need to cut through really tough materials like say concrete or brick. The individual diamond crystals exposed on the edge and sides of the rim do the cutting. The operator pushes the rotating blade into the surface of the material, causing the diamonds to cut a groove in the material.

such small diameter blades use sintered and Vacuum Brazed welding, they need more sharp. Glass is a beautiful and translucent material but is also Hard and brittle. Because of this glass requires a very abrasive blade with very cool properties to reduce heating of the blade. Most diamond glass blades are made with very fine diamonds implanted into the rim of the blades segment. Glass blades in almost all occasion continuous rim to reduce aggressive friction which may cause cracks or harsh rough cuts. The wastewater from food & beverage plants often contains high concentrations of biochemical oxygen demand (BOD), chemical oxygen demand (COD), suspended solids (TSS), fats, oils and nutrients in varying concentrations.
